The currency exchange emoji features a bold, black circle with arrows forming a square around it. This symbol represents financial transactions involving the exchange of different currencies. Its design makes it recognizable in contexts related to international finance. If someone sends you a 💱 emoji, they are likely talking about currency exchange or financial transactions.
The 💱 Currency Exchange emoji represents the concept of currency exchange, where one type of currency is converted into another, such as when exchanging dollars for euros.

The 💱 currency exchange emoji was introduced in Emoji E0.6 and is now supported across all major platforms including iOS, Android, Windows, and macOS.
The 💱 currency exchange emoji belongs to the Symbols category, specifically in the Currency Symbols subcategory.
Most platforms show 💱 with ¥ (Yen/Yuan), $ (Dollar), and € (Euro) - three major world currencies. Some variations include £ (Pound). The design reflects international money exchange services, typically found at airports and banks.
| Unicode Name | Currency Exchange |
| Apple Name | Currency Exchange |
| Unicode Hexadecimal | U+1F4B1 |
| Unicode Decimal | U+128177 |
| Escape Sequence | \u1f4b1 |
| Group | ㊗️ Symbols |
| Subgroup | 💲 Currency Symbols |
| Proposals | L2/09-026, L2/07-257 |
